Gold Fields Divests Entire Stake In Galiano Gold For About C$151 Mln

Gold Fields Limited subsidiaries have fully divested their entire 19.5% stake in Galiano Gold Inc., selling 50.47 million common shares at C$3.00 each for gross proceeds of C$151.41 million. This transaction marks Gold Fields' complete exit from Galiano, providing significant capital to the company and representing a notable shift in Galiano's institutional ownership structure.

Analysis

Gold Fields Limited (GFI) has executed a complete divestiture of its 19.5% equity stake in Galiano Gold Inc. (GAU), selling 50.47 million shares for total gross proceeds of approximately C$151.41 million. This transaction, conducted at C$3.00 per share, provides Gold Fields with a significant capital infusion, which can be deployed towards core operational priorities or balance sheet strengthening. The positive sentiment signal (0.5) for GFI suggests the market views this as a successful monetization of a non-core holding and a sound portfolio optimization strategy. For Galiano Gold, the exit of a major institutional shareholder marks a pivotal change in its ownership structure. While this event resolves the potential overhang of a large block of shares coming to market, it simultaneously introduces uncertainty regarding the identity and intentions of the new holder(s) of this significant stake, a fact reflected in GAU's neutral sentiment score.
